computer programming for beginners for Dummies

The most well-liked package deal supervisor is called npm, or Node Package Supervisor, but You may as well use A different supervisor named Yarn. Each are very good solutions to be aware of and use, although it’s most likely greatest to start out out with npm.

And freeCodeCamp has their own YouTube channel, with films similar to a Learn JavaScript course along with other in-depth courses.

To really make it simpler to accessibility and deal with your version control system, You may use a services like GitHub, or possibilities like GitLab and Bitbucket.

Objective Digger Redefining what accomplishment means And exactly how you can find a lot more joy, simplicity, and peace from the pursuit of your respective goals

Github also supports rendering of PDF paperwork, so developers can retail store code in essential text variety or maybe by utilizing a PDF converter.

Servers are definitely the hardware and software which make up your computer. Servers are to blame for sending, processing, and acquiring data requests. They’re the intermediary among the database as well as client/browser.

Nowadays You can also find serverless architectures, which can be a far more decentralized kind of setup. This type of software splits up those elements and leverages 3rd party sellers to deal with each of them.

Why would a person go with a CMS around coding “by hand” or “from scratch?” It’s real that a CMS is considerably less flexible and, for that reason, provides you with much less Command around your front conclusion.

You can even revert into a preceding modify in case you create a oversight. It’s almost like having infinite save details on your project, and allow me to let you know, it may be an enormous lifesaver.

You'll be wanting to have the ability to answer plenty of the exact same questions as These I set on the entrance-end roadmap, along with some further center on subject areas like how APIs work:

SourceTree: SourceTree is often a free of charge Git consumer for Windows and macOS that provides a visual interface for interacting with Git check here repositories. It tends to make handling the historical past of one's project and visualizing typical Git functions more simple. 

Model Management can help you Management, observe, and Manage diverse variations of your respective again-end projects. Git is unquestionably the ideal-recognised and most favored Model Management system, but You will also find other choices like SVN and Mercurial.

To master Website development expertise, a student ought to come from a computer science background. Aside from this, they have to also have some prior knowledge about programming languages particularly Utilized in the web development process, for example Python, HTML CSS and JavaScript, or other programming languages that are generally utilised.

With this book, you may build a Functioning web application so you'll obtain palms-on working experience. Together the way, you are going to follow approaches employed by professional Rails builders. And I'll enable you to understand why Rails is a popular choice for Internet development.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“computer programming for beginners for Dummies”

Leave a Reply

Gravatar